    Mendocino cannabis equity grant: Big boost for local growers

    Change is in the air—and the soil—here in Mendocino County, as the Mendocino cannabis equity grant takes center stage. Cannabis cultivators are watching this new grant program closely. With a shifting landscape in policy and a fierce spotlight on social equity, there’s more at stake than ever for local small growers looking for real opportunities. This article examines the grant’s deeper impact, the underlying legal landscape, and what it means for the future of Mendocino’s cannabis community.

    Understanding the Roots: Regulation, Equity, and Rural Realities

    Mendocino County isn’t just a blip on the cannabis map, it stands as a key battleground for cannabis law and social justice in California. Legal cannabis in California remains a tightrope walk. License caps, cost barriers, and local red tape squeeze the little guys hardest, especially BIPOC and legacy cultivators. The California Cannabis Equity Act set the tone for social equity, pushing counties to prioritize those most impacted by historical prohibition. But translating that spirit into real-world support is still a struggle. According to Leafly, most equity applicants face overwhelming bureaucracy, staggering overhead costs, and limited access to capital.     Key Developments, The Mendocino Cannabis Equity Grant Unpacked

    Let’s dig into the headlines. Local lawmakers in Mendocino County recently announced a new infusion of funds, over $1.5 million, targeted at supporting small-scale cannabis growers with roots in the community. According to The Press Democrat, these grants address generational harms caused by the War on Drugs and aim to help farmers comply with state and local regulations. Other regions have seen aggressive enforcement actions, such as the mass cannabis destruction by authorities in Edo, sparking debate about the industry and social equity. Applications for the Mendocino cannabis equity grant opened in October 2025, with priority given to those who can prove historical disadvantage or legacy status. Eligible growers get direct cash grants, technical assistance, and business coaching. Local equity applicants must document residency, income, and the impact of past cannabis convictions, requirements designed to keep aid focused and effective. Meanwhile, Mendocino’s Board of Supervisors is pushing state agencies for greater transparency and flexibility, especially after feedback from grassroots cannabis advocates and the California Cannabis Industry Association indicated many rural applicants face steeper barriers than their urban peers.

    Expert Analysis, Why This Matters for the Whole Industry

    The Mendocino cannabis equity grant is more than a cash infusion, it’s a statement. In the words of cannabis policy wonk Amanda Reiman (as reported by Marijuana Moment): “Equity programs only make a difference when backed by serious resources and on-the-ground support. Mendocino is showing what happens when a community actually listens to its legacy growers.” Industry trends back this up. National data from New Frontier Data shows fewer than 15% of social equity cannabis applicants make it to licensure without additional support. Grants like Mendocino’s can mean the difference between shutting down and scaling up, which is much like the current buzz around record-breaking retail milestones in regulated markets, including reports of record cannabis sales creating new industry excitement. Plus, these programs give hope to legacy cultivators, those whose work predates legalization but whose skills, genetics, and local knowledge are literally the roots of California’s cannabis economy.
